The person you will be in 5 years depends on:
• the food you eat
• amount of exercise you do
• how much sleep per day
• books or articles you read
• how much more you write
• money you save and invest
• who you work with
• friends you spend time with
• new skills you develop
• connections you make and keep
• promises you make and keep
• where and how far you travel
• doors you open for others
• knowing when to leave
• new habits you develop
• quitting the stuff that holds you back

Harsh Truth: You'll literally never know what you want to be when you grow up.
The idea that you should know what you want to do with your life by the time you are 20 is one of the worst lies we are told.
I spent years stressing out over my lack of a clearly defined path...
But then I realized that most hyper-successful people still have no idea what they want to do.
They just have a bias for action that has allowed them to capitalize on opportunities and compound effectively over time.
If you have a bias for action, you'll always be fine.
